Inherited Forms of the Disease

Familial Parkinson’s disease accounts for about 10-20% of cases, where a clear pattern of inheritance is observed. You’re likely to be affected by this form of the disease if you have a first-degree relative, such as a parent or sibling, who’s been diagnosed with Parkinson’s.

Research has identified several families with a high incidence of Parkinson’s disease, enabling scientists to pinpoint the underlying genetic causes.

You’ll notice that inherited forms of Parkinson’s can be broadly classified into two categories: autosomal dominant and autosomal recessive. Autosomal dominant forms of the disease are caused by mutations in a single copy of a gene, and you have a 50% chance of passing it on to each of your children.

Autosomal recessive forms, on the other hand, require mutations in both copies of a gene, and you’re more likely to be affected if both parents are carriers of the mutated gene.

Genetic Risk Factors and Variants

Your genetic makeup plays a significant role in determining your risk of developing Parkinson’s disease, even if you don’t have a family history of the condition. Research has identified multiple genetic variants associated with an increased risk of Parkinson’s.

These genetic variants can affect different pathways and mechanisms within the body, ultimately contributing to the development of Parkinson’s disease.

Several genes have been linked to Parkinson’s disease, including SNCA, PARK2, DJ-1, and LRRK2. Variants in these genes can lead to the production of toxic proteins or disrupt normal cellular processes, increasing the risk of Parkinson’s.

Additionally, genetic variants in the GBA and MAPT genes have also been associated with an increased risk of Parkinson’s.

It’s essential to note that having one of these genetic variants doesn’t guarantee you’ll develop Parkinson’s disease.

Many people with these variants won’t develop the condition, and many people without these variants will still develop Parkinson’s.

How Genetics Affect Disease Progression

Genetic variants don’t just influence your risk of developing Parkinson’s disease – they can also impact how the condition progresses. Research suggests that certain genetic mutations, such as those in the LRRK2 and GBA genes, can affect the rate at which Parkinson’s disease advances.

For example, individuals with the LRRK2 mutation tend to experience a slower progression of motor symptoms, while those with the GBA mutation may experience more rapid cognitive decline.

Durability and Maintenance Tips

Proper maintenance is crucial for extending the life of your heavyweight truck tyres. Regular checks can help identify potential issues before they become major problems.

You should check your tyres' air pressure at least once a week, as under-inflated tyres can lead to uneven wear and reduced traction. Also, make sure to check the tread depth and look for signs of uneven wear, such as feathering or cupping.

You should also rotate your tyres regularly to ensure even wear and extend their lifespan. Most manufacturers recommend rotating tyres every 5,000 to 8,000 miles.

Additionally, you should check your truck's wheel alignment and suspension system regularly to prevent uneven tyre wear.

Choosing the Right Tyre Type

When choosing the right type of tyre for your heavyweight truck, you're not just picking a product – you're investing in the safety and efficiency of your vehicle. The right tyres can provide improved traction, better handling, and increased fuel efficiency.

You'll need to consider the specific needs of your truck, including the terrain you'll be driving on, the weight capacity, and the speed at which you'll be driving.

For example, if you'll be driving on rough terrain or in extreme weather conditions, you'll want tyres with aggressive tread patterns for improved traction. If you'll be driving long distances on the highway, you'll want tyres that are designed for fuel efficiency.

You'll also need to choose between different types of tyres, including all-position, drive, and trailer tyres.

All-position tyres are designed for versatility and can be used in multiple positions on the truck. Drive tyres are designed for the drive axle and provide improved traction. Trailer tyres are designed for the trailer axle and provide improved durability.

Types of Roofing Materials

When choosing a roofing material for your home, you're faced with a wide range of options, each with its own set of advantages and disadvantages. Asphalt shingles are a popular choice, known for their affordability and ease of installation. They come in a variety of colors and styles, making them a versatile option for many homeowners.

Clay and concrete tiles offer durability and resistance to harsh weather conditions, but they can be heavy and expensive.

Metal roofing is another option, providing excellent protection against weathering and potential damage. It's also environmentally friendly, as many metal roofs are made from recycled materials.

Slate tiles are a premium option, offering a unique look and exceptional durability. However, they can be expensive and require specialized installation.

Wood shingles and shakes provide a natural, rustic look, but they require regular maintenance to prevent damage.

Properties of Alumina Ceramic

Alumina ceramic's exceptional properties make it a prime material in electronics. When you look at its physical characteristics, you'll notice that alumina ceramic has a high melting point, which exceeds 2000°C. This property makes it an ideal choice for high-temperature applications.

Additionally, alumina ceramic is extremely hard, with a Mohs hardness of 9, making it resistant to scratches and wear.

Its electrical properties are also noteworthy. Alumina ceramic is an excellent insulator, with a high dielectric strength and low dielectric loss. This means it can withstand high voltages without breaking down and can help reduce energy losses in electronic circuits.

You'll also find that alumina ceramic has a high thermal conductivity, allowing it to efficiently dissipate heat away from electronic components.

In terms of chemical properties, alumina ceramic is highly resistant to corrosion and can withstand exposure to harsh chemicals.

Its inert nature also makes it non-reactive with other materials, reducing the risk of contamination.
